
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ky stated he had a “good and productive” assembly with US President-elect Donald Trump and French chief Emmanuel Macron Saturday and that they sought after the conflict with Russia to finish rapid and “in a just way.”
The trio met on the Elysee Palace in Paris, virtually 3 years into Moscow’s invasion and forward of Trump taking administrative center in the USA in January.
“I had a good and productive trilateral meeting with President Donald Trump and President Emmanuel Macron at the Elysee Palace,” Zelensky stated on social media.
“We all want this war to end as soon as possible and in a just way,” he stated.
He thanked Macron for setting up the assembly and stated: “President Trump is, as always, resolute. I thank him.”
Zelensky stated the trio had “agreed to continue working together and keep in contact.”
His administrative center exempt pictures of Zelensky shaking palms with Macron and Trump throughout the Elysee administrative center.
PUNCH On-line experiences that Trump in September accused Ukraine’s chief, Volodymyr Zelensky of refusing to “make a deal” to finish his nation’s conflict with Russia.
“We continue to give billions of dollars to a man who refuses to make a deal, Zelensky,” the Republican White Space candidate stated in sharply important remarks at a marketing campaign rally in North Carolina.
“Every time he came to our country, he’d walk away with $60 billion,” Trump had stated, derisively describing the Ukrainian president as “probably the greatest salesman on Earth.”
“What do you have left now?” Trump had sneered. “The country is absolutely obliterated.”
